D class destroyer leader The D class (or Darrus class) leaders were a new generation of Wesmeric destroyers designed under treaty limitations, utilizing twin high angle 4.7" gun mounts compared to the singles that were the standard before. These new mounts were able to fire at high flying targets, however the train rate wasn't sufficient enough to track aircraft very effectively yet. These destroyers were well regarded for being good sea boats even in the Freyatic's rough seas. The D class was built to lead squadrons of E and F class destroyers, most of which were built during or after the construction of the Ds. Displacement - 1860 tonnes standard Speed - 35.5 knots Range - 7000 nm at 14 knots Main battery - 3x2 120mm/45 Torpedoes - 5x2 533mm Ships in class Darrus - sunk in action, 1342 Dionisia - mined, 1344 Defiant - sunk by aircraft, 1346 Dauntless - scrapped, 1350 Danworth - sunk in action, 1343 Dolores - sunk in action, 1344 Darcie - sunk in action, 1345 Daring - sunk in action, 1342 Doubtless - sunk in scuttled, 1345 Doralyn - torpedoed, 1346 |

Type 1335 class destroyer The Type 1335s were the first Siegmaric destroyers to utilize dual purpose artillery for their main battery, inspired by the fact that Antarans were doing it with their Arabella class ships. The Type 1335s were also the first Siegmaric destroyers built under treaty limits, displacing 1510 tonnes standard. Despite the improvement in AA capability, without proper fire control and further innovations with flak shells, these destroyers did not provide adequate air defense when the World War came around, as demonstrated by a surprising amount of losses to aircraft. The majority of vessels that survived the war with sunk during gunnery training by Antara, or simply scrapped by Desnia. Displacement - 1510 tonnes standard Speed - 37 knots Range - 5000 nm at 14 knots Main battery - 5xI 128mm/45 Torpedoes - 2xIV 533mm with 4 reloads Ships in class Z84 - scuttled, 1348 Z85 - sunk in gunnery training, 1356 Z86 - sunk by air attack, 1348 Z87 - sunk by air attack, 1344 Z88 - sunk in surface action, 1345 Z89 - scuttled, 1348 Z90 - sunk in gunnery training, 1351 Z91 - sunk by air attack, 1346 Z92 - scrapped, 1352 Z93 - scuttled, 1348 Z94 - sunk in gunnery training, 1355 Z95 - sunk in surface action, 1344 Z96 - sunk in surface action, 1345 Z97 - sunk by air attack, 1345 Z98 - scrapped, 1354 Z99 - sunk by air attack, 1346 Z100 - scuttled, 1348 Z101 - sunk by air attack, 1344 Z102 - torpedoed by submarine, 1347 |

G class destroyer The G class were an incremental improvement of the D class leaders. The most notable change on what would've otherwise been a repeat, was the two smoke stacks, reverting back to the original boiler arrangement of pre-D class destroyers. The Wesmeric Admiralty weighed the risks and benefits and decided to go back. Other improvements include the relocation of her quad 40mm mount, an additional 20mm on the broadside, the removal of a whaleboat for additional space, and an improved director which eliminated the issue with having a split fire-control for surface and anti-aircraft combat. Blanks - https://imgur.com/a/Xml5z2m Displacement - 1880 tonnes standard Speed - 36 knots Range - 6800 nm at 14 knots Main battery - 3xII 120mm/45 Torpedoes - 2xIV 533mm Ships in class Graceful - scrapped, 1351 Greyhound - sunk by air attack, 1343 Gallant - sold to Zhangzhou, 1351 Garnet - mined, 1343 |
